From b22affe0aef429d657bc6505aacb1c569340ddd2 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Leonid Shatz Date: Mon, 4 Feb 2013 14:33:37 +0200 Subject: hrtimer: Prevent hrtimer_enqueue_reprogram race hrtimer_enqueue_reprogram contains a race which could result in timer.base switch during unlock/lock sequence. hrtimer_enqueue_reprogram is releasing the lock protecting the timer base for calling raise_softirq_irqsoff() due to a lock ordering issue versus rq->lock. If during that time another CPU calls __hrtimer_start_range_ns() on the same hrtimer, the timer base might switch, before the current CPU can lock base->lock again and therefor the unlock_timer_base() call will unlock the wrong lock.
